Transformation

With the increase in complexity of the business environment and transactions, CFOs of private equity backed companies are increasingly being looked towards to drive strategic insights for their business.  Finance organisations are no longer simply result reporters, but rather, they couple these results with forward looking data to provide strategic insights which are leveraged to make business decisions.  Efficiency of process and meaningful control environments allows for speed of financial reporting with increasingly accurate measures, leaving more time for the finance team to add future enterprise value, rather than look backwards.

Accordion’s Transformation Practice is comprised of a dedicated team providing strategic advice to support PE backed portfolio companies on a wide range of transactions and events, including profitability improvements, finance process optimisation, liquidity enhancements and digital transformation transaction.  We are doers and problem solvers – making sense of complexity and bolstering sponsors’ value creation theses.
